The proverb is about how money can distort people's judgment. 👉 When a person becomes wealthy or powerful, people may judge their actions by their success rather than by whether those actions are actually wise or correct. DEEPER MEANING: 1. Success Can Make People Forgive Failure When a wealthy person makes a bad decision, people may say: “He probably knows something we don't.” But when a poor person makes the same mistake: “That's why he's poor.” The action is identical; the interpretation changes. 2. Wealth Creates an Illusion of Competence People often assume that because someone succeeded financially, they must be intelligent in every area of life. But financial success does not automatically equal wisdom. 3. People Respect Results More Than Reasoning If a wealthy person's risky decision eventually succeeds, people may call it brilliant—even if it was originally based on poor judgment. Likewise, a wise decision that fails because of bad circumstances may be unfairly called foolish. 4. Money Can Protect Reputation Wealth can sometimes give people enough social influence that others minimize, excuse, or forget their mistakes. 👉 The Irony Two men make exactly the same mistake. The poor man: “What a foolish decision!” The rich man: “What a bold strategy!” 👉 Same mistake. 👉 Different bank balances. MORAL LESSON: Never measure wisdom by wealth, and never assume a successful person is right simply because they are successful. The deeper warning is against worshipping success. Money can make people listen to you, respect you, and even defend you, but it cannot turn a bad decision into a good one.
